About Zhihui Yü

Zhihui Yü is a scholar working on Plant Science, Applied Microbiology and Biotechnology and Genetics, having authored 46 papers that have together received 1.5k indexed citations. Recurring topics across this work include Plant Disease Resistance and Genetics (19 papers), Wheat and Barley Genetics and Pathology (14 papers) and Chromosomal and Genetic Variations (13 papers). The work is most often cited by research in Plant Science (680 citations), Cardiology and Cardiovascular Medicine (402 citations) and Molecular Biology (897 citations). Zhihui Yü has collaborated with scholars based in China, United States and Canada. Frequent co-authors include Glenn I. Fishman, Thomas E. Bureau, Stephen Wright, Thomas V. McDonald, Zhenglin Yang, Guangrong Li, Quang Hien Le, Zhen Ming, Marian B. Meyers and Eugen Palma. Their work appears in journals such as Nature, Proceedings of the National Academy of Sciences and Journal of Biological Chemistry.
